The Center for Thinking Biblically is a hub of resources from experts ranging from theologians to paleontologists affiliated with The Master’s University in Santa Clarita, CA. Created by educators passionate about exalting Christ in all things, these resources are designed to equip believers with a biblical way of thinking about every aspect of the world.The Master’s University Copyright 2023 All rights reserved.
